Dismissed
The appeal concerning the issue of entitlement to service connection for erectile dysfunction is dismissed as it was duplicative, untimely, and moot.
The deciding factor: The June 2025 appeal seeking to appeal an April 4, 2024, decision is also moot because the AOJ fully granted the benefit sought.
